Benzaldehyde, 2,4-bis(1-methylethyl)-
2,4-di(propan-2-yl)benzaldehyde
Also Known As: 2,4-Diisopropylbenzaldehyde|2,4-Bis(isopropyl)benzaldehyde|Benzaldehyde, 2,4-bis(1-methylethyl)-|2,4-di(propan-2-yl)benzaldehyde|2,4-diisopropyl benzaldehyde|EINECS 270-621-1|2,4 - bis(isopropyl)benzaldehyde|2,4-bis(propan-2-yl)benzaldehyde|2,4-Bis(1-methylethyl)benzaldehyde
| Molecular Formula | C13H18O |
|---|---|
| Molecular Weight | 190.13577 g/mol |
| LogP | 3.75 |
| Topological Polar Surface Area | 17.07 Ų |
| Hydrogen Bond Donors | 0 |
| Hydrogen Bond Acceptors | 1 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 3 |
| Exact Mass | 190.13577 |
| Heavy Atoms | 14 |
| Complexity | 324.0 |
Chemical Identifiers
| CAS Number | 68459-95-0 |
|---|---|
| SMILES | CC(C)C1=CC(=C(C=C1)C=O)C(C)C |
